was a Japanese samurai of the late Edo period who fought for the Satsuma Domain at the Battle of Shiroyama.
He was a samurai of the Satsuma Domain, and an associate of Saigà  Takamori. Beppu joined Saigà Â's forces during the Satsuma Rebellion. At the end of the rebellion in September 24, 1877, it was Beppu who was the second at Saigà Â's seppuku. After Saigà Â's death, the vastly outnumbered Beppu and the other ex-samurais charged against the ranks of the attacking Imperial Japanese Army forces, and were killed.
